Introduction to NoMad

NoMad, short for “North of Madison Square Park,” originated in New York City. The first NoMad hotel was opened in 2012 by the Sydell Group, founded by Andrew Zobler, in partnership with designer Jacques Garcia and chef Daniel Humm and restaurateur Will Guidara of Eleven Madison Park fame. This hotel was a game-changer in the hospitality industry, offering a more intimate, boutique experience with a focus on elegance, comfort, and exceptional dining. The success of the NoMad in New York City laid the groundwork for its expansion to other locations, including Las Vegas.

Las Vegas: A New Chapter

The NoMad Las Vegas represents a significant chapter in the brand’s history, as it marks the first foray into a resort setting. Located on the top four floors of the Park MGM, NoMad Las Vegas offers a unique experience that contrasts with the typical Vegas vibe. With 293 rooms and suites, a private pool, and a distinct entrance, NoMad provides an exclusive escape within the larger resort. This setting allows guests to enjoy the best of both worlds: the luxury and intimacy of a boutique hotel and the amenities and entertainment options of a full-scale resort.

Before NoMad: The Transformation of Park MGM

To truly understand what NoMad Las Vegas was before, it’s necessary to look at the history of the Park MGM itself. Previously known as the Monte Carlo Resort and Casino, Park MGM has a rich history dating back to its opening in 1996. Designed to evoke the charm of the Place du Casino in Monte Carlo, the resort quickly became a staple on the Las Vegas Strip, known for its European flair and family-friendly atmosphere.

Renovation and Rebranding

In 2016, MGM Resorts International announced a major renovation and rebranding effort for the Monte Carlo, aiming to transform it into a more modern, upscale resort. This multi-million dollar project involved a complete overhaul of the property, including the addition of new dining venues, entertainment options, and, of course, the NoMad Las Vegas. The goal was to appeal to a more discerning clientele, offering a sophisticated and luxurious experience that would stand out from other properties on the Strip.
